
The hit series The Golden Girls has stood the test of time and continues to be a cultural phenomenon even close to 30 years after it went off the air. There is just something so nice about these 4 women all bonding and going through life's challenges together that many viewers found appealing. Throughout the mid to late 1980s and the early 1990s, the 4 seniors were welcomed into the homes of millions of television viewers. People are still streaming the show these days as well, either experiencing it for the first time or going back and reliving it.
